    It is a universal law that we create through our beliefs, This is also proven through extensive scientific research and we also know that to attract what we desire we first have to become it, so if we are looking for a secure dynamic we have to constantly check our own energy and I will always use the 3 main modalities -

    EFT - Using a sequence of light tapping on the meridians of our body, connecting with our feeling world using this somatic practice to bring us home to our truest essence. This amazing technique helps us to understand our feeling world and to process through anything heavy & to bring compassion to ourselves and connect to our intuition.

    Reparenting - Giving ourselves the love, understanding and validation that we were unable to receive in times of trauma. We give to ourselves in new ways that help to energetically fill our own cup and understand our own needs, totally eradicating some triggers as we let go of trauma stored in the body.

    Byron Katies Self Enquiry work- Questioning the untrue beliefs we gave to ourselves in times of trauma, hopefully bringing us to a place of empowerment.

    If our caregivers weren't able to regulate their own nervous system and process through their own feelings then we likely got shut down, shamed and even punished for having big feelings as a child. Regulating our emotions was a very valuable process that all children need to be taught, so this can be passed along generationally. If this was not taught to us as infants we must learn to do this work for ourselves as adults, if we want to experience healthy dynamics as an adult.

    If our caregivers weren't able to meet our emotions with care and understanding, as infants, then we will internalise their own lack of regulation as something that meant something negative about us and give ourselves negative and untrue beliefs about ourselves. These negative and untrue beliefs need to be questioned and reflected upon to understand them and to see how & when they were originally created and how they are still playing out and creating a reality that we don't want, in the present moment.
